拟卤素化合物Cu[N(CH_2OH)_2CH_2O](SCN)的合成、晶体结构和磁性

Synthesis,Structural Characterization and Magnetic Property of Cu[N(CH_2OH)_2CH_2O](SCN)
下载PDF
导出
摘要 使用常规的合成方法获得一个结构新颖的拟卤素化合物Cu[N(CH2OH)2CH2O](SCN),并对该化合物进行红外光谱、CHN和ICP元素分析、表面光电子能谱(XPS)等谱学表征;X-射线单晶衍射分析表明该化合物具有单核结构,并通过分子间O—H…O氢键形成了一维超分子链状结构;变温磁化率研究表明,该化合物具有反铁磁性相互作用。 A s upramolecular coordination polymer Cu IN (CH2OH)2CH2O] (SCN) (1) has been synthe- sized and its structure has been characterized by elemental analyses ,infrared spectroscopy ,X-ray photo- electron spectroscopy (XPS) and single crystal X-ray diffraction structure analysis. The molecule of compound 1 has the discrete structure which is linked by the intermolecular O--H2O hydrogen bonds into one-dimensional chain. This compound displays antiferromagnetic interaction.
